Narrative:Auster AOP.6 VF563 (Ferry Pilots Pool): Written off (destroyed) 12.12.46 when stalled and spun into the ground whilst turning onto the crosswind leg of the circuit at RAF Aston Down, Minchinhampton, Gloucestershire. Crashed at Frampton Mansell, just to the northeast of the airfield.
Crew:
F/O (187894) Edwin Charles Dale Colton DFC (pilot 187894) RAFVR: killed
Buried at Rake Lane Cemetery, Wallasey, Wirral, Cheshire R.I.P.
Frampton Mansell is a small English village 5 miles (8 km) ESE of Stroud, in the parish of Sapperton. It is lies off the A419 road between Stroud and Cirencester.
